SUMMARY

On a COMPAQ SLT/286, the communications port and its associated interrupt can be set by using the Setup/Diagnostic program included with the computer. The following is the procedure:

    Place the Setup disk in your floppy drive.
    Run the Setup program.
    At the menu screen, press F4 to select "change configuration."
    From the next menu screen, select "Modem async-device."
    From the next screen, select "system async device."
    From the next screen, select "com1."
    From the next screen, select "interrupt 4."
    Exit through the screens until you return to the MS-DOS prompt.
